    How to change a series of positive numbers to negative numbers

    I have a column with 2 reason codes in. One is 256, which gives in a
    preceding column a positive number. The other is 356, which in the same
    preceding column is also giving a positive number, which should actually be
    shown as a negative number. All these figures are random.

    Is there any way of changing the several hundred rows with reason code 356
    to show the quantity figure as being a negative?

    Good afternoon Ellie

    You could achive this using a "helper" column. Say A=256 / 356, B= your quantity and your first row is row 1. In column C use the formula:

    =IF(A1=256,B1,B1*-1)

    and copy it all the way down.

    Once done, you could use Copy-Paste As function to convert the formula back into "proper" numbers.

    Simplest way is to use a spare working column say C.

    Assuming the values are in column A and the codes in column B, enter
    the following in C1

    =if(B1=356,a1*-1,a1)

    Copy it down column C.
    Then Edit Copy the whole of Column C and Edit PastSpecial Value into
    Column A.
